dc.description.abstractThis study entitled “HEALTH PROBLEM OF DOMESTIC CHILD LABOUR IN BHAISEPATI AREA OF LALITPUR SUB METROPOTITAN"was carried out in order to identify the situation of DCLs, health problem of DCLs, the study is mainly based on primary data collected form Bhaisepati Area of Lalitpur Sub Metropolitan City, using purposive sampling techniques. The number of DCLs interviewed was 112 and 10 key people interviewed from Local Organization/Association/Club, School Head, and Political parties, Ward Committee Head, Women Representative and Health Person. All completed interview schedule were checked, coded, classified and tabulated to make more clear and scientific. Simple statistical tools such as frequency distribution, average and percentage were used to analyze the different aspects related to the objectives of the study. It was found that most of the DCLs were female. It concluded that the majority of the DCLs were between 14 to 16 years. The study proves that the poor educational background of parents was the determining factor to send their children to work. Most of them were from Chhetri group in the comparison of the other castes. The large number of DCLs left their home by their parents' suggestion. Their family's occupation was agriculture; like wise poverty is main reason for working. Most of the DCLs weren't clear about future perspective. Most of the DCLs had taken bath one time in a week. They had brushed their teeth twice a day. Most of the DCLs took tobacco and had their own separate room to sleep at 9 o'clock. They took meal at the same time with their employee family members.Largest number of DCLs was suffered from diarrhoea and typhoid, jaundice pneumonia were the main health problems faced by them and they had got general treatment. They go to public hospital; the bill for the treatment was paid by the house owner. In conclusion, poverty and parents force are the main reasons to be a child labours. Hence,the government should develop well plan and should implement poverty alleviation and income generation skill development programs in rural areas. Likewise, free health and education program should be launched in rural areas specially targeting to poor families.en_US
